iOS: версии Pro / Lite с предварительной компиляцией в Xcode - PullRequest
0 голосов
/ 21 февраля 2012

У меня есть проект, чья цель про приложения. Я хочу сделать облегченную версию, но не создавать другой проект и скопировать и вставить файлы из полного проекта. Есть ли какой-нибудь способ предварительной компиляции в XCode, чтобы сделать две настройки сборки и скомпилированный код для версий Pro и Lite?

1 Ответ

2 голосов
/ 21 февраля 2012

Вы можете дублировать текущую цель приложения и добавить некоторые макросы препроцессора. Скажите LITE для облегченной версии, затем в вашем коде сделайте что-то похожее на:

#ifdef LITE
//Lite
#else
//Pro
#endif
...